Surface Acidities of Bentonite, Sepiolite, and Synthetic Silica-Aluminas

Abstract

The surface acidities of Bentonite, Sepiolite, and Silica-Aluminas were determined by Hammett indicators, amine titrations, and of pyridine adsorption-IR spectroscopy. The quantitative estimation of surface acidities of silica-aluminas and their natures as Brønsted and Lewis acid sites were evaluated. Lewis and total surface acidity values of sepiolite were higher than bentonite, 0.53 and 2.22 mmole g-1, respectively. Surface acidity values of sepiolite and bentonite were much lower than Siral compounds. Among the Siral compounds, Siral 30 was found to be more effective in terms of acidity. All samples have both Lewis and Brønsted acid centers in which the Lewis sites predominated. IR spectroscopy with pyridine as a probe molecule was still very useful for the estimation of the surface acidities of the silica-alumina and also aluminosilicate structures such as clays and clay minerals.
